On 5/21/2020 7:48 PM, Dr. David Alan Gilbert wrote:
> * Kirti Wankhede (kwankhede@nvidia.com) wrote:
>> Define flags to be used as delimeter in migration file stream.
>> Added .save_setup and .save_cleanup functions. Mapped & unmapped migration
>> region from these functions at source during saving or pre-copy phase.
>> Set VFIO device state depending on VM's state. During live migration, VM is
>> running when .save_setup is called, _SAVING | _RUNNING state is set for VFIO
>> device. During save-restore, VM is paused, _SAVING state is set for VFIO device.

>> +/*
>> + * Flags used as delimiter:
>> + * 0xffffffff => MSB 32-bit all 1s
>> + * 0xef10 => emulated (virtual) function IO
>> + * 0x0000 => 16-bits reserved for flags
>> + */
>> +#define VFIO_MIG_FLAG_END_OF_STATE (0xffffffffef100001ULL)
>> +#define VFIO_MIG_FLAG_DEV_CONFIG_STATE (0xffffffffef100002ULL)
>> +#define VFIO_MIG_FLAG_DEV_SETUP_STATE (0xffffffffef100003ULL)
>> +#define VFIO_MIG_FLAG_DEV_DATA_STATE (0xffffffffef100004ULL)
>> +

> Hi,
> This is still the only bit which worries me, and I saw your note
> saying you'd tested it; to calm my nerves, can you run with the
> 'qemu_loadvm_state_section_startfull' trace enabled with 2 devices
> and show me the output and qemu command line?
> I'm trying to figure out how they end up represented in the stream.
>
Created mtty devices for source VM:
echo "83b8f4f2-509f-382f-3c1e-e6bfe0fa1233" >
/sys/class/mdev_bus/mtty/mdev_supported_types/mtty-2/create
echo "83b8f4f2-509f-382f-3c1e-e6bfe0fa1234" >
/sys/class/mdev_bus/mtty/mdev_supported_types/mtty-2/create
for destination VM:
echo "83b8f4f2-509f-382f-3c1e-e6bfe0fa1235" >
/sys/class/mdev_bus/mtty/mdev_supported_types/mtty-2/create
echo "83b8f4f2-509f-382f-3c1e-e6bfe0fa1236" >
/sys/class/mdev_bus/mtty/mdev_supported_types/mtty-2/create
Source qemu-cmdline:
